Subject matter

Unit 1: TRENDS IN INFORMATION SYSTEMS

  • Data modeling techniques in Engineering - overview
  • Distributed and Federated Information Systems
  • Multimedia Information Systems
  • Intelligent contents

 

Unit 2: COMPUTATIONAL INTELLIGENCE AND QUALITATIVE REASONING

  • Computational intelligence methods
  • Qualitative modeling and reasoning
  • Decision Making : models, systems, taxonomy of decisions
  • Decision Support Systems
  • Decision Making under uncertainty
    • Fuzzy Sets Theory
    • Fuzzy Optimization
    • Fuzzy Multiple Criteria Decision making
    • Fuzzy Inference systems   Recommended bibliographic references:

 

Unit 3: KNOWLEDGE DISCOVERY AND DATA MINING

  • Principles of machine learning
  • Other data mining algorithms
  • Data pre-processing and standards

 

Unit 4: SYSTEMS INTEGRATION

  • Integration needs, levels, and challenges
  • Reference architectures and frameworks.
  • Approaches and technologies

 

Unit 5: ENTERPRISE INTEROPERABILITY

  • Data morphisms, model morphisms and transformations
  • Semantic harmonization and adaptability
  • New methods and tools for interoperability of complex systems

Bibliography

Unit 1: TRENDS IN INFORMATION SYSTEMS

-       Garita, C.; Afsarmanesh, H.; Hertzberger, L.O. (2001). The PRODNET Federated Information Management Approach for Virtual Enterprise Support. Journal of Intelligent Manufacturing, Vol. 12, Issue 2.

-       Afsarmanesh, H.; Guevara, V.; Hertzberger, L.O. (2004).     Federated management of information for TeleCARE. Proceedings of TELECARE 2004 - Int. Workshop on Tele-Care and Collaborative Virtual Communities in Elderly Care. INSTICC Press.

-       Kosch, H. & Döller, M. (2005). Multimedia Database Systems: Where are we now? IASTED DBA. Innsbruck, Austria.

-       Heesch, D. & Rüger, S. (2004). NNk Networks for Content-Based Image Retrieval. CIVR. Dublin, Ireland.

-       Wang, Y.; Liu, Z.; Huang, J.-C. (2000). Multimedia content analysis: Using both audio and visual clues. IEEE Signal Processing Magazine, Volume: 17,  Issue: 6.

-       Camarinha-Matos, L.M. Data modeling in engineering – course notes. http://www.uninova.pt/~cam/mde/mde.doc

 

Unit 2: COMPUTATIONAL INTELLIGENCE AND QUALITATIVE REASONING

-          Pedrycz, W. and F. Gomide (2007). Fuzzy Systems Engineering- Toward Human-Centric Computing, John Wiley & Sons.

-          Ross, T. (2004). Fuzzy Logic with Engineering Applications, John Wiley & Sons.

-          Chen, Z. (2000). Computational Intelligence for Decision Support, CRC Press.

-          Li, H. X. and V. C. Yen (1995). Fuzzy sets and fuzzy decision making, CRC Press.

-          Bellman, R. E. and L. A. Zadeh (1970). "Decision-Making in a Fuzzy Environment." Management Science Vol. 17(No.4): 141-164.

-          Zadeh, L. A. (1965). "Fuzzy Sets." Information and Control 8: 338-353.

-          Yoon, K. P. and C.-L. Hwang (1995). Multiple attribute decision making, Sage Publications

 

Unit 3: KNOWLEDGE DISCOVERY AND DATA MINING

-          K. Cios, W. Pedrycz, R. Swiniarski, L. Kurgan, Data Mining: A Knowledge Discovery Approach, Springer, 2007.

-          Hastie, T., R. Tibshirami, et al. (2001). The Elements of Statistical Learning. Data Mining, Inference and Prediction, Springer.

-          Berson, A. and S. J. Smith (1997). Data warehousing, data mining & OLAP, McGraw-Hill.

-          Chen, Z. (2001). Data Mining and Uncertain Reasoning - An Integrated Approach, John Wiley & Sons.

-          Cios, K. J., W. Pedrycz, et al. (1998). Data Mining Methods for Knowledge Discovery, Kluwer.

-          Mitchell, Tom. Machine Learning, McGraw Hill, 1997.

-          Fayyad, U. M. , Piatetsky-Shapiro, G.,  Smyth, P.,  Uthurusamy, R. Advances in Knowledge Discovery and Data Mining, AAAI Press/ The MIT press, 1996

 

Unit 4: SYSTEMS INTEGRATION

-         Chen, D., Doumeingts, G., & Vernadat, F. (2008). Architectures for enterprise integration and interoperability: Past, present and future. Computers in Industry 59(7), 647-659.

-         Panetto, H., & Molina, A. (2008). Enterprise integration and interoperability in manufacturing systems: Trends and issues. Computers in Industry 59(7), 641-646

-         Camarinha-Matos, L.M.; Afsarmanesh, H. (2003). Designing the information technology subsystem, invited chapter, in Handbook on Enterprise Architecture, P. Bernus, L. Nemes, G. Schmidt (Eds.), Springer, 2003, pp. 617-680, ISBN 3-540-00343-6.

 

Unit 5: ENTERPRISE INTEROPERABILITY

-          Enterprise Interoperability III: New Challenges and Industrial Approaches, Kai Mertins, Rainer Ruggaber, Keith Popplewell, Xiaofei Xu; Springer; ISBN: 978-1848002203, June 2008

-          Journal of Intelligent Manufacturing, special issue on “E-Manufacturing and Web-Based Technology for Intelligent Manufacturing and Networked Enterprise Interoperability”, Panetto, Hervé and Jardim-Gonçalves, Ricardo and Pereira, Carlos, eds. Vol. 17 (6). pp. 639-640. ISSN 0956-5515, 2006.

-          Ontologies in the Context of Information Systems; Sharman, Raj and Kishore, Rajiv and Ramesh, Ram; Springer; ISBN 978-0-387-37019-4, 2006

-          Exploring complexity; Gregoire Nicolis, Ilya Prigogine; Freeman, ISBN 071671859-6, 1989
